    Can a smart management of hydropower help power West Africa?

    A smart management of hydropower, combined with solar and wind energy, can provide the flexibility needed to power West Africa and at cheaper cost than using natural gas, according to a simulation model.

    What is the West African renewable power database (warpd)?

    The database of the present and future hydro, solar and wind power projects in West Africa developed for this work is named the West African Renewable Power Database (WARPD). It combines information from existing databases, scientific papers, technical project descriptions, newspaper articles and tender documents for future projects.

    What percentage of West Africa's electricity is generated by hydropower?

    Hydropower provides 20% of West Africa's electricity with the remainder mostly generated from natural gas and oil 30, and thus currently accounts for nearly all of its RE. In a few countries, hydropower dominates the generation mix (Fig. 1a ).

    Where is electricity most difficult in West Africa?

    Access to electricity is most challenging in the western part of SSA. Data from the World Bank indicates that, as of 2019, more than half of the population of West Africa (51.1%) lacks access to electricity . Further, rural areas, which are home to 49% of the total population of West Africa (WA), had an electrification rate of only 28% .

    Containerised Power Stations (CPS) refer to the power station composed of one or more containerized generator sets, which is composed of main container, auxiliary container and oil storage tank.

    How does a solar inverter work?

    Solar panels generate DC power, while household appliances operate on AC power, as supplied by the electricity grid. The primary role of a solar inverter is to convert DC solar power to AC power. The solar inverter is one of the most important parts of a solar system and is often overlooked by those looking to buy solar energy.
